Output 2e63aa57843b3a3b54a52079259fdf901efd1333997e501e8620536f9d70e77d:0
- value
- 21098734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52b4a478e670159295030e58a08c817124a53e4a OP_EQUAL
- address
- MFSU3RGBLvusHn1on4Nj3Bj4LY4v2TsiQa
- transaction
- 2e63aa57843b3a3b54a52079259fdf901efd1333997e501e8620536f9d70e77d
- spent
- true